Description:

Having recently been crowned as one of the Top 50 Model SDG Zones by Global Alliance for Special Economic Zones (GASEZ), National Science and Technology Park (NSTP) is at the forefront of promoting inclusivity to benefit underserved populations through tailored innovation programmes like the Entrepreneurial Startup Skillset Training for Youth (ESSY), Rising Stars Startup Competition (RSSC) for women and ethnic minorities, Prime Minister's National Innovation Award (PMNIA) for youth, and the Badiri Programme for women.  

Moreover, NSTP's skill development workshops for minorities and women focused initiatives play an active role in empowering marginalized communities. The Parks’ inclusive spaces, facilities, and policies reinforce NSTP's dedication to creating an environment where everyone feels valued and empowered. As NSTP expands its initiatives, it continues to champion inclusivity, diversity, and empowerment for societal progress and economic growth in Pakistan, aligning with the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and the global movement towards inclusive innovation.
